UPDATE: Zuzanna Matula has been located and is safe.

SPRINGFIELD, VA—Fairfax County Police are seeking help to locate an endangered woman from Springfield.

Zuzanna Matula, 18, was last seen Sunday, April 28 in the 5400 block of Easton Drive. She is considered endangered due to physical or mental health concerns.
